GOLD IN THE WAIKATO. [BY TELEGRAPH.— OWN CORRESPONDENT.] Auckland, Friday Night.
The Waipa Prospecting Association have sent down several samples of quartz to be tested bv tho Government analyst. Two samples have lnon tested, aud the result showed bullion «i h >th, but in one in particular, the ass.iy «h nving per ton, silver, Gdwts *13{?rs; gol'l, 3dwts Ogrs. This sample was taken fr«»m the suiface of the reef where.-it is oiei t>U feet wide. ? Tho association propose Uking out soveral tons and having it sent to the Thames to be put through the La Monte process.
